Conformal curved slotted patch antenna

2010 
An antenna 110, or a method of manufacturing an antenna, comprises a dielectric layer 212 with first and second curved surfaces 816, 818 where the first curved surface 818 of the dielectric layer 212 is positioned over the outer curved surface of a body 810 and an antenna layer 214 is positioned over the second surface 816 of the dielectric layer 212 and is arranged to conform to this surface. The said body 810 may be formed of electrically conductive material and could be a hinged driveshaft cover for a helicopter tail boom. A rectangular or bow-tie shaped slot 216 may be arranged to extend along the majority of the length of the antenna layer and may be centre fed at points 830 on either side of the slot 216 via a current balancing structure 860 such as a microstrip balun. The dielectric layer 212 may be made of thermoplastic, syntactic foam or polymer foam approximately 10 — 50 mm thick. The antenna 110 may provide vertical and horizontal polarization signals in different respective frequency bands. The antenna may include a protective outer layer which includes a low dielectric loss quartz fibre composite material 820 and/or a lightning strike applique covering 825.
